OPI Gargantuan Green Grape

Price:

$7-$9 for 0.5 Fl Oz (15 ml), price may vary store to store.

Packaging:

This milky pastel green nail lacquer comes in a sturdy glass packaging with classy black cap which is wow factor of whole packaging for me! It is slightly runny as compared to other OPI nail lacquers and I need at least 3-4 coats for buildable, clean, opaque finishing! OPI nail lacquer packaging is travel friendly and free of DBP, Toluene and formaldehyde.

My Experience with OPI Nail Lacquer – Gargantuan Green Grape:

This gargantuan green grape is a pastel green, non-shimmery milky shade to me which is slightly runny in texture as compared to other saucy OPI nail paints in my stash! Like any pastel shade, it is tricky on my light Asian skin which neither brightens up my skin tone nor makes it look darker. It works fair on my light skin thankfully.

I am surprised to notice that it looks a bit streaky and uneven in first two swipes. I need 3-4 swipes for buildable coverage as well as clean finishing.  It also takes a good amount of time to dry up unless I blow air on my hands. This is my first OPI nail paint which takes multiple swipes to give clean finishing and pigmentation, and it is a slightly messy task for mums like me. Moreover, I always noticed multiple coats often chip and peel really fast as compared to single/double coats on my nails.

Let’s sum up pros and cons:

Pros of OPI Nail Lacquer – Gargantuan Green Grape:

  • A milky pastel green shade apt for summers.
  • It is a non-shimmery, slightly runny in texture shade, will suit every light Asian skin tone.
  • It gives a glossy, clean finish on my nails irrespective of using a base coat or top coat.
  • It manages to survive 6-7 days without fading or chipping.
  • The glossy shine and finish stays longer even when the nail paint starts chipping off.
  • Travel-friendly and mess-free packaging.

Cons of OPI Nail Lacquer – Gargantuan Green Grape:

  • It looks goopy and watery in the first two swipes, I need 3-4 swipes for a neat and glossy finish.
  • Takes quite a lot of time to dry completely in between each coat.
  • It starts chipping off by 7th-8th day.
  • It’s a tricky shade.
